Alleged Philly Mob Boss, Associates in Court

The men were arrested and charged with running illegal gambling operations and engaging in loan sharking.

The reputed boss of the Philadelphia mob and two others are scheduled for bail hearings in federal court.

Prosecutors said in an indictment unsealed this week that alleged mob boss Joseph "Uncle Joe" Ligambi, reputed underboss Joseph "Mousie" Massimino and others ran illegal gambling operations and engaged in loan sharking.

Ligambi, Massimino and a third alleged associate are scheduled for bail hearings at 1:30 p.m. Thursday before a federal judge in Philadelphia.

Ligambi pleaded not guilty during an initial appearance Monday. Massimino said in court that day that he didn't yet have an attorney and he has not entered a plea.
